# Working of Area Of Service

Users can create Service Area in an Individual Detail Map by using 6 ways-

by File, by Proximity, by Region, by Drawing, by Territory & By Overlay. Let us consider by Proximity.

After creating the shape, the user can select the shape using align tool & right-click over it to select the Area of Service option to assign Service Area for individual records.

Once the area is assigned, the map can be refreshed to see the assigned Service Area for individual records.

Using the Area of Service template, the user can see the records that lie within the created Service Area. For example, doctors can see patients' records which are falling under their service region.

There are two ways to save the Area of Service template,

1\. Using the Area of Service tab, which is configured by the user,

2. Using Plot cards either by location or by region on the individual map

Plotting a Shape Layer on the created Service Area. This can be done by clicking on the ‘Show Region Boundary’ on the right
